How to Use These Sleep Affirmations
- Choose a Few Affirmations: Select 3-5 affirmations that resonate with your current state of mind. Focus on ones that address your specific sleep challenges, whether it’s calming a busy mind, releasing stress, or waking up energized.
- Repeat Them Consistently: Say your affirmations aloud or in your mind as part of your nighttime routine. Repeat them slowly and with intention.
- Pair with Relaxation Techniques: Combine affirmations with deep breathing, meditation, or calming music to amplify their effect.
- Write Them Down: Place written affirmations next to your bed or journal about them to reinforce their power.
Why Sleep Affirmations Work
Sleep affirmations are effective because they gently rewire your thought patterns. By focusing on positive and calming statements, you’re replacing stress and negativity with peace and reassurance. Over time, these affirmations create a mental environment conducive to restful sleep, making it easier for you to relax and recharge.
